Mr James Gray (North Wiltshire, Conservative)

I understand my hon. Friend's point and I may well be ready to go some way down the road with him. However, will he not concede that given that the tests are subjective and that the Bill does not lay down precisely what judgment the registrar must make, it will be necessary for him to understand, for example, what is meant by a pack of hounds and how a pack operates? Otherwise, how can he hope to make any kind of subjective judgment?
